Purchasing Permits

Whether residing on or off campus, students must register their vehicle with Parking Services if operating on campus. If living on campus, you must have 28 credits finalized with MSU to be automatically eligible to purchase a permit. Unless virtual, permits must be properly affixed to the lower left, driver's side, of the windshield. Those parked without proper permits displayed are eligible for violations. Permits can be purchased in the permit portal. View permit details by scrolling further down on this page.

Permit Return

If you no longer need your current student permit, it should be returned to Parking Services. If eligible for a pro-rated refund, one will be issued based on refund rates at the time of return. If the permit is virtual, a photo of the email confirmation of purchase can be used in place of photos of the physical permit. Contact Parking Services for further details about your specific permit.

Student permits are NOT valid at individual meters, pay-by-plate lots, university vehicle spaces, loading zones, leased spaces, visitor/patient spaces, or employee areas. Vehicles must be parked in designated parking spaces within the permitted lot to have valid parking. Permits are not valid during special events. Download the student parking and driving regulations document for more information: Student Parking-Driving Regulations

 

PERMIT WAITLISTS: If the permit you wanted to purchase is currently sold out, you may place yourself on the designated waitlist online through the parking permit portal. If a permit becomes available and you're next on the list, you will be notified of your eligibility. You can sign up for multiple waitlists.
